次の方法で共有


ACPI_METHOD_ARGUMENT_LENGTH マクロ

ACPI_METHOD_ARGUMENT_LENGTH マクロは、指定したサイズのデータを含む可変長 ACPI_METHOD_ARGUMENT 構造体のサイズをバイト単位で計算します。

構文

void ACPI_METHOD_ARGUMENT_LENGTH(
    DataLength
);

パラメーター

DataLengthACPI_METHOD_ARGUMENT 構造体のデータ配列のデータ サイズ (バイト単位)。

戻り値

可変長 ACPI_METHOD_ARGUMENT 構造体のサイズ (バイト単位) であり、 サイズ (バイト単位) が DataLength であるデータ配列が含まれています。

解説

ドライバーはこのマクロを使用して、可変長 ACPI_METHOD_ARGUMENT 構造体の必要なサイズ (バイト単位) を計算することができ、構造体には指定されたサイズ (バイト単位) のデータ配列を含めることができます。

要件

ターゲット プラットフォーム: デスクトップ

ヘッダー: acpiioct.h (Acpiioct.h を含む)

関連項目

ACPI_METHOD_ARGUMENT